Abstract
An alternative to the thyristor controlled reactor is proposed based o n the ability of the AC/DC convertor to absorb controllable reactive p ower. The standard three-phase bridge configuration is modified, using the concept of DC ripple reinjection, to achieve high pulse operation without the need for passive harmonic filtering. A 36-pulse scaled-do wn test system is used to verify the theoretical predictions.
